Notes

This album was originally issued as Slash #SR-104 (Apr 80). Recorded at Golden Sound Studios, Hollywood, CA, USA (Jan 80).

Tracks 10 to 14 are bonus tracks. T10 & T12 recorded at Kitchen Sync, Hollywood, CA, USA (1977). T11 & T14 recorded at Hound Dog Studios, Los Angeles, CA, USA (1978). T13 recorded at X's Garage (6th St. & Van Ness), Los Angeles, CA, USA (1977).

T3 originally by The Doors. T10 & T13 previously unissued in any form. A remixed version of T11 was issued as Dangerhouse single #D-88 (released Jun 78). T12 first issued on the album "Beyond And Back: The X Anthology" (Elektra #62103), released 28 Oct 97. T14 from the compilation EP "Yes L.A." (Dangerhouse #EW-79), released Aug 79.

CD contains a 20-page booklet with lyrics for tracks 1 to 9, plus a text by Kristine McKenna and photos/flyers of the band not available in the original release.
